Levi's Strauss's Financial Panic

The loss of the Central America meant that over a million dollars in gold was now at the bottom of the Atlantic and not in New York bank faults. depositors began to withdraw their accounts at a frightening rate and the entire American economy shriveled. Levi's Strauss survived and actually prospered because his suppliers were his own brothers.
